92TripleBlack said:
I believe the finish for the dash changed from '04 to '05. For what year did you find it a missmatch?
Yeah 05-06 changed the Radio bezel and Shifter console to either a brushed aluminum finish on LE's, and a funky CF looking one for the SE. All other dash trim pieces stayed the same color.

Last I checked Nissan was only selling the Double-Din bezel in the original 04 grey color. May have changed by now and added the newer year trim colors?

I'm changing out my bezel and shifter console to the 05 brushed aluminum this weekend, so I have researched this crap pretty well. :D
